Piggybacking off the Amazons discussion earlier in this thread. Spoilers for Amazons S2
The under suits of Amazon Neo and Alpha aren't 1:1 palette swaps of each other: The green marks on Alpha are jagged and mostly short, resembling scars Jin gets in battle. In comparison, the red marks on Neo are longer and thinner because they're supposed to resemble black veins humans get once they're infected with the Lysogenic Amazon Cells: https://vignette.wikia.nocookie.net/...20170819034703 This is because Chihiro is actually one of the origin points of the Lysogenic Amazon Cells. |

The most direct reference/relation is that G3 is based off of Kuuga and Hikawa mentions Kuuga by his police moniker Unidentified Lifeform no. 4 early on in the show during a briefing in regards to the Unknown and Agito if I remember correctly. It was after episode 1 for sure but I can't remember exactly which episode. Either 2 or 3. Also the Guard Chaser's ignition mechanism is the same as Kuuga's Try Chaser and Beat Chaser.
